Manufactura industrial
Internet industrial de las cosas | Materiales industriales | Mantenimiento y reparación de equipos | Programación industrial |
home  MfgRobots >> Manufactura industrial >  >> Industrial Internet of Things >> Computación en la nube

Las aplicaciones nativas de la nube gobernarán el mundo

Últimamente nos hemos encontrado con muchos comentarios sobre aplicaciones "nativas de la nube". (¡Incluso tienen su propia base!) Los desarrolladores crean estas aplicaciones específicamente para ejecutarse en una infraestructura basada en la nube, con el tipo de interfaz de usuario que todos esperamos de nuestras aplicaciones ahora. Las aplicaciones nativas de la nube son escalables, utilizables y flexibles, generalmente empaquetadas usando contenedores.

Es un paso más en el viaje de la computación en la nube y un paso más allá de la forma en que solíamos concebir las aplicaciones. El desarrollo de aplicaciones ocurrió durante muchos años dentro de una burbuja de TI, con un largo ciclo de vida de desarrollo e implementación. Se usaron solo internamente, en computadoras de escritorio, que también estaban en un ciclo de actualización estricto y no ágil.

Las cosas han cambiado. Las empresas ahora dependen tanto o más de las aplicaciones de nivel empresarial, pero la forma en que se desarrollan, implementan y utilizan las aplicaciones ha cambiado drásticamente. Muchos de ellos aún logran los mismos objetivos de los trabajadores:Microsoft Word, Office 365 o Google Docs me dan una página en blanco para trabajar, pero sus funciones se han expandido para incluir compartir, ediciones y actualizaciones instantáneas, notificaciones y más. (Eso sin mencionar la gran demanda de aplicaciones optimizadas para dispositivos móviles).

Sin embargo, lo más importante es que estas aplicaciones no están amuralladas en una burbuja de TI y todo sucede mucho, mucho más rápido. El desarrollo es más rápido y más ágil en procesos y equipos. Y los usuarios de hoy responden a una mala experiencia al no usar la aplicación en absoluto.

Todas las aplicaciones deben coincidir

El objetivo final de crear aplicaciones nativas de la nube es que todas las aplicaciones puedan ejecutarse en cualquier nube y funcionar como parte de la infraestructura de una empresa. Las aplicaciones nativas de la nube también reducen mucho el desperdicio de la infraestructura tradicional, ya que no hay un exceso de codificación de funciones o uso de recursos duplicados como antes. Están construidos para escalar rápida y horizontalmente, en lugar de agregar capacidad para escalar. Estas aplicaciones modernas también hacen uso de las tecnologías de apoyo con las que interactúan, como nuevas herramientas y métodos de almacenamiento.

También hay un paso más allá en la creación de verdaderas aplicaciones nativas de la nube, donde el concepto de una aplicación refleja la forma en que funciona la nube para que el procesamiento y los datos estén separados y la aplicación se base en una colección de servicios.

Las aplicaciones se distribuyen, al igual que las TI, y se sirven desde muchas nubes diferentes. Para los equipos de TI que crean y usan estas aplicaciones, el cielo es el límite. Este enfoque nativo de la nube facilitará la conexión y la administración de ubicaciones remotas y permitirá que la computación en la nube haga el trabajo de consolidar los sistemas. Las aplicaciones nativas de la nube también pueden ayudar a una empresa a escalar cuando es posible que no pueda escalar internamente por sí misma.

Hemos recorrido un largo camino más allá de las aplicaciones locales que se actualizan anualmente y que evolucionan lentamente para convertirnos en las aplicaciones actuales listas para la nube. A lo largo del camino, hemos visto muchos intentos de poner esas aplicaciones locales en la nube, con diversos grados de éxito. Muchos todavía se encuentran en el centro de datos, existiendo como aplicaciones heredadas para algún propósito específico. Incluso esas aplicaciones deberán incorporarse de alguna manera, ya sea que se ajusten a los estándares de la nube o que encuentre una nueva aplicación que pueda satisfacer la misma necesidad empresarial.

Independientemente de las aplicaciones que proporcione y respalde, esté atento al premio de la TI moderna:mantener contentos a los usuarios finales. Eso es lo que proporcionan estas arquitecturas de aplicaciones:una experiencia de usuario sencilla y sencilla que no requiere mucho trabajo práctico de tickets o parches de la mesa de ayuda. Idealmente, los usuarios interactuarán con la tecnología que necesitan para hacer su trabajo sin enfrentar problemas que se interpongan en su camino.

Con la expansión de las aplicaciones nativas de la nube, será esencial considerar el propósito de cada aplicación y cómo se implementa mejor, incluso aquellas torpes que languidecen en el centro de datos. Eventualmente, todas sus aplicaciones comerciales deben cumplir con algunos objetivos básicos:experiencia positiva para el usuario final, escalabilidad y flexibilidad.


Computación en la nube

  1. La nube y cómo está cambiando el mundo de las TI
  2. Desarrollo de aplicaciones nativas de la nube en Azure:herramientas y sugerencias
  3. Las 5 herramientas en la nube de AWS que necesitará para tener éxito
  4. Aplicaciones de IA en la cadena de suministro global
  5. Todas las aplicaciones de los pigmentos de ftalocianina
  6. Todas las aplicaciones de los tintes básicos
  7. El mundo de los tintes textiles
  8. Todas las aplicaciones del pigmento azul
  9. ¿5G cumplirá la visión de 2020?
  10. IoT está en camino de comerse el mundo móvil. ¿Cómo?
  11. Mantenimiento en el mundo digital